American Airlines Adds Bimini, Bahamas Flights from Miami Feb 2026

American Airlines said it will begin flights between its hub in Miami and Bimini, Bahamas, on Feb. 14.

The service will fly once in each direction on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Saturdays on an Embraer E175 jet operated by one of American’s regional affiliates.

“American knows that travelers are looking for unique and varied experiences, and that’s why we’ve added destinations like Bimini to our network,” American’s Senior Vice President of Network Planning Brian Znotins said in a news release. “We recently announced new routes for travelers to explore unique architecture in Prague or Budapest or ski down exciting slopes in Sun Valley, and now we’re offering a new island option in the Bahamas.”

Although the American flights are more expensive for travelers departing from Miami than other options like ferries and sea planes – fares appear to start at around $430 round-trip in basic economy, compared to fares in the $200 range with other companies – the ability to connect to Bimini without leaving the Miami airport could be a convenient draw for American Airlines customers from other origin points.
